Steps to reproduce:
 - Open the server's channel list (F5)
 - Focus the tree view (leaving the channel list as current tab)
 - Press *any* key on your keyboard, other than up or down arrows

Konversation immediately crashes:

When the tree view is focused, pressing arrow keys moves around in the list,
while pressing other keys such as a letter focuses the text input of the open
tab and enters the letter there instead. However, a channel list has no text
input, so item->getView()->getTextView() returns null in
ViewTree::keyPressEvent, and the attempt to re-send the QKeyEvent to it (null)
causes a crash.

This only happens with the channel list. I didn't yet find why it doesn't
happen for other text-input-less tabs such as Watched Nicks, URL Extractor,
etc.
